Wesley Stahler
LMFT, ECMH, RDT
Wesley Stahler is a mama of two (crowning achievement), in addition to a Licensed Marriage & Family Therapist, Early Childhood Mental Health Clinician, Registered Drama Therapist & Buddhist practitioner. Babies are her business! She has over 26 years of experience working in the Early Childhood world, initially at a Montessori School, followed by producing kids TV for Nickelodeon, to over 10 years working at UCSF Benioff Hospital Oakland, in their Behavioral Pediatrics Program. In addition to Soothe, she also has a Strength-based, private practice providing relational support for children, families and parents. Specialties with pediatric anxiety disorders (OCD, phobias, and anxiety), early childhood ages 0-6, pre and post-natal anxiety and depression, co-parenting, behavioral challenges and creating behavioral contracts, substance use, impulsivity, parental competencies. Plus, she co-created and leads Girl Group, which she describes as Soothe for kiddos 7-17 years old.
